Brief exposure to pollution-causing particles triggers lung infections in children

Even the briefest increase in airborne fine particulate matter PM2.5, pollution-causing particles that are about 3% of the diameter of human hair, is associated with the development of acute lower respiratory infection in young children, according to newly published research.

Positive results for unprotected left main coronary artery PCI with drug-eluting stents

Patients with normal left ventricular function who undergo elective unprotected left main coronary artery (ULMCA) perc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I) with drug-eluting stents (DES) had favorable outcomes according to new research. Results of the multicenter, retrospective study are reported in the June issue of Catheterization and Cardiovascular Interventions, a journal published by Wiley-Blackwell on behalf of The Society for Cardiovascular Angiography and Interventions (SCAI).

PTA balloon catheter for high pressure dilation procedures

Invatec, a comprehensive innovator of interventional products, today announced the availability of REEF HP, a PTA Balloon Catheter, ideal for use in all peripheral high pressure dilatation procedures. The "lesion-specific" design of the balloon material is particularly useful in "hard-to-dilate" situations and the availability of variable shaft lengths mean that the Reef HP is equally suited to both arteriovenous (AV) shunts (50cm shaft),and peripheral applications (80/120cm shaft).

Cardiovascular Disease: An internist who specializes in diseases of the heart and blood vessels and manages complex cardiac conditions such as heart attacks and life-threatening, abnormal heartbeat rhythms.
